Words like: (Brace yourself) Sham, Freaker, Legend, Header, Buck, Ram, Lawd, and many many more. Those are just single words used to describe people. Wait till you hear the figures of speech.
''You goin on the beer tonight lawd?'' (Are you going drinking tonight, friend?)
''Well sham, waddya at?'' (What are you up to, friend?)
''You headin ta peppers tonight boy?'' (Are you going to the local diner tonight, friend?)
''I'll seeya when you're on the steam down at da Wudoo'' (I will see you when you are drunk down at Voodoo (Local nightclub), friend)
''Did ya see the new (Car) and (Insert person here) stuck a (Car part) in her hey. She goes like a wild bull now boy'' (Did you see the new car which some person stuck a new car part in? It goes very fast now, friend?)
Loads more, though I'd bore you with them.
